The attack on the Christmas market in Strasbourg, which killed five people on December 11th, seems to have been premeditated. This is what emerges from the first elements of the investigation, revealed by our confreres of the World . Cherif Chekatt, its author, would have actively sought weapons the previous days and entrusted to his mother his " desire to die ".

In the aftermath of the attack on Strasbourg's Christmas market, the authorities remained very cautious. Cherif Chekatt was indeed wanted for another common law case and a search had then taken place at his home, without him being there. We thought then that it was this search that had triggered his action. But the more investigations progress, the more the investigators are convinced that Cherif Chekatt was feeding this long-deadly project.

First of all, there was the claim video found in his apartment during the search. Wearing a keffiyeh, he lends allegiance to the Islamic State group. But there is especially the testimonies collected by the police including those of two friends that Chérif Chekatt solicited from the month of September to obtain weapons. Weapons that he would have procured the morning of the attack, even if the investigators have yet to clarify this point.

Last element: the behaviors of Chérif Chekatt. This time his family put the bug in the ears of the investigators. A family of 12 brothers and sisters who did not appear very surprised by the act of their brother. The terrorist's mother even admitted that the latter had told her in July that she wanted to die , but she did not take it seriously.
